Building a successful HACCP program includes the following:

Preliminary steps:

  • Assemble a HACCP Team.

  • Describe product.

  • Identify intended use.

  • Construct a flow diagram.

  • Verify the flow diagram.

 

The Seven HACCP Principles:
  • Conduct a Hazard Analysis (Physical, Chemical, Biological).

  • Determine CCPs using a decision tree.

  • Establish critical limits for each CCP.

  • Develop a monitoring system for each CCP.

  • Determine corrective actions.

  • Establish verification procedures.

  • Develop record keeping and documentation procedures.
